Running on a Treadmill

A treadmill is an exercise equipment that lets a person run, walk, or jog in place. It is a popular choice in gyms as well as at homes treadmills are a very popular exercise equipment. It also helps people stay active when the weather gets bad.

Running on a treadmill can strengthen the thighs and glutes. They also help burn calories and improve the health of your cardiovascular system. It is important to consult with a fitness professional before running on the treadmill.

It's simple to use

Running on a treadmill is an effective method of burning calories and build endurance. It helps strengthen your muscles in the legs, back and abdomen, and prevent injury. In addition, it improves cardiovascular health and lowers blood pressure. It is essential to use your treadmill correctly to avoid injury. If you are just beginning start at the lowest possible speed and gradually increase it as you get used to the treadmill. If you're using the treadmill's incline feature with a small angle, and then increase it gradually.

Training for strength can be incorporated into your treadmill workouts. To ensure your safety it is advised to stay away from jumping off and on a treadmill that is moving. Instead, you should stop and do exercises for strength such as lifting weights, or doing body-weight exercises such as push-ups and Squats. You can then jump back on the treadmill and continue your exercise. By doing this you can meet both your aerobic and strength-training goals in the same day.

Treadmills are especially useful to train for races because you can set your pace and track your heart rate. You can also utilize the incline dial to mimic the terrain of a racecourse that is beneficial when preparing for a marathon. Certain treadmills let you lower the slope. This is a great option for training downhill.

Take a few minutes to warm up before and after working out on the treadmill. Don't forget to wear running shoes and a top that fits well. It's also recommended to tie the safety cord to your clothing in the event that you fall off the machine.

While treadmills can be a bit intimidating for those who are new to the sport however, they are simple to master. There are many gyms that have staff available to help you learn the basics. You can also consult the treadmill manual to learn tips on how to use your particular model of treadmill.

It's secure

A treadmill is one the most secure pieces of fitness equipment you can get at home. It offers a smooth, cushioned surface for running or walking, and it can be adjusted to simulate different terrains. The most important thing is to use proper posture, which means maintaining your shoulders back and looking ahead instead of down at your feet. This can help prevent knee and joint injury.

Make sure you read the manual before purchasing a treadmill. It will contain information about the safest method of using the treadmill, as well as the safety tether that keeps you from falling off the treadmill. The manual will also tell you how much space you need to leave around the treadmill. It's best to have at minimum 19.7 inches on either side of the treadmill and 78 inches behind it.

A safety belt is another important element. This will keep you from getting pulled into the motor and can help you avoid serious injuries. It is also important to check the treadmill on a regular basis for loose bolts or screws. Be sure to tighten them frequently, particularly if you're going to be using it frequently.

Treadmills could be dangerous if they're not maintained correctly. You should check the deck, tread belt and power cord to make sure they're secure. You should also regularly clean the machine to prevent dust and debris from building up. In addition it's a good idea to install an appropriate safety tether clip as well as an emergency key. This will ensure that the treadmill is stopped immediately if you accidentally fall off.

It's crucial to keep track of your progress and avoid overdoing it. It's also important to do warm-up and cool-down exercises before and after your workout. This will increase your performance and help prevent injuries.
